RenkoGurus-SmartChannel is a powerful Renko-based trading system designed to help traders identify key reversals, trend shifts, breakouts, and breakdowns with precision. This guide provides a detailed breakdown of all the signals, their meanings, and how traders can effectively use them for scalping, trend trading, and momentum-based setups.


1️⃣ Reversal Signals (Key Turning Points in Price Action)

Reversal signals help traders identify potential market turning points by detecting momentum shifts, exhaustion zones, and critical support/resistance levels.

📍 Rank Long Reversal

🔹 Indicates: A strong bullish reversal from a key support level. 🔹 Usage: Ideal for long entries when price shows signs of reversal. 🔹 Confirmation: Works best with Lower Channel Breakout (LCB) or Cloud Long Reversal.

📍 Rank Short Reversal

🔹 Indicates: A strong bearish reversal from a resistance level. 🔹 Usage: Ideal for short entries when price starts to reverse downward. 🔹 Confirmation: Stronger when combined with Upper Channel Breakdown (UCB) or Cloud Short Reversal.

📍 Cloud Long Reversal

🔹 Indicates: A bullish reversal forming inside or near the AI-powered cloud. 🔹 Usage: Suggests buying opportunities when price finds support within the cloud. 🔹 Confirmation: Best when supported by a Rank Long Reversal or Lower Channel Breakout.

📍 Cloud Short Reversal

🔹 Indicates: A bearish reversal forming inside or near the AI-powered cloud. 🔹 Usage: Suggests selling opportunities when price meets resistance inside the cloud. 🔹 Confirmation: Stronger when aligned with Rank Short Reversal or Upper Channel Breakdown.

📍 Lower Channel Breakout (LCB )

🔹 Indicates: A bullish breakout from the lower channel boundary, signaling a potential trend reversal to the upside. 🔹 Usage: Suggests a buy setup when combined with Rank Long Reversal or Cloud Long Reversal.

📍 Upper Channel Breakdown (UCB )

🔹 Indicates: A bearish breakdown from the upper channel boundary, signaling a potential trend reversal to the downside. 🔹 Usage: Suggests a short setup when combined with Rank Short Reversal or Cloud Short Reversal.

✅ Best Practices for Reversal Signals:

  • Look for alignment across multiple signals (Rank + Cloud + Channel) for higher probability trades.

  • Avoid counter-trend reversals unless supported by strong rejection signals.

  • Trade with caution when reversals occur within the UltraTrend Cloud, as they may indicate a temporary pullback instead of a full trend change.


2️⃣ Channel Breakout & Breakdown Signals (Momentum-Based Continuations)

These signals identify strong breakouts and breakdowns, signaling momentum-based trend continuation trades.

📍 Channel Breakout

🔹 Indicates: A bullish breakout above the upper channel boundary, signaling trend continuation. 🔹 Usage: Suggests buying into strength when momentum aligns with UltraTrend Cloud direction. 🔹 Confirmation: Stronger when backed by Rank Long Reversal or Cloud Long Reversal.

📍 Channel Breakdown

🔹 Indicates: A bearish breakdown below the lower channel boundary, signaling trend continuation. 🔹 Usage: Suggests shorting into weakness when the market structure confirms further downside. 🔹 Confirmation: More reliable when combined with Rank Short Reversal or Cloud Short Reversal.

✅ Best Practices for Breakout & Breakdown Signals:

  • Breakouts work best after a period of consolidation.

  • Breakdowns are more effective when supported by Rank Short Reversal signals.

  • Be cautious of false breakouts—wait for confirmation using UltraTrend Cloud direction.


3️⃣ Support & Resistance-Based Rejections (Failure Points in Price Action)

Rejection signals occur when price fails to break through a key level, indicating a high-probability reversal.

📍 Top Rejection (🔽 Resistance Rejection )

🔹 Indicates: A failed breakout at resistance, signaling a potential short trade. 🔹 Usage: Ideal for shorting opportunities when price struggles to move higher. 🔹 Confirmation: Works best when combined with Rank Short Reversal or Upper Channel Breakdown.

📍 Bottom Rejection (🔼 Support Rejection )

🔹 Indicates: A failed breakdown at support, signaling a potential long trade. 🔹 Usage: Ideal for long entries when price bounces off a key support level. 🔹 Confirmation: Stronger when backed by Rank Long Reversal or Lower Channel Breakout.

✅ Best Practices for Rejection Signals:

  • Combine with channel boundaries for extra confirmation.

  • False breakouts and breakdowns can lead to sharp reversals—be ready to react.

  • If price continues consolidating after a rejection, it may signal a breakout in the opposite direction.


4️⃣ UltraTrend Cloud Confirmation (Macro Trend Bias Filter)

The UltraTrend Cloud serves as a trend filter, helping traders align their trades with the larger market direction.

📍 UltraTrend Cloud Bullish (Blue/Green Zone)

🔹 Indicates: A strong uptrend, suggesting long trades have higher probabilities. 🔹 Usage: Focus on Rank Long Reversal, Channel Breakout, and Cloud Long Reversal setups. 🔹 Avoid: Short trades unless supported by major reversal signals.

📍 UltraTrend Cloud Bearish (Red/Orange Zone)

🔹 Indicates: A strong downtrend, suggesting short trades have higher probabilities. 🔹 Usage: Look for Rank Short Reversal, Channel Breakdown, and Cloud Short Reversal setups. 🔹 Avoid: Long trades unless strong reversal signals appear.

✅ Best Practices for UltraTrend Cloud Signals:

  • Use UltraTrend Cloud to filter trade opportunities—favor setups aligned with the trend.

  • When the cloud shifts direction, it may signal a major trend change—watch for confirmation before acting.

  • If price stays within the cloud, avoid trading as it indicates choppy market conditions.
